This is a beautiful felted rug made from Flo, who is a Herdwick Sheep. Herdwick sheep originally live on the slopes and pastures of England's highest mountains. To withstand the elements, they have wiry, thick, warm wool that keeps them cosy. Due to this fact, sometimes these fleeces can moult when felted, and it does vary from sheep to sheep. This is because the sheep actually have two coats - one is like a woolly jumper, and then there's an outer coat that is hairy. It's this part of the fleece that has a tendency to moult.
